史弼 / Shi Bi (late Han)
Overview
Shi Bi enters the wiki through Hanji 877 as the Pingyuan chancellor who refuses to fabricate party-member names under campaign pressure.
Current Profile
Hanji 877 places Shi Bi inside the administrative aftermath of the first Party Prohibition. As commanderies and kingdoms report lists of party figures, Shi Bi reports that Pingyuan has none. When Qingzhou pressure arrives, he refuses the logic that every jurisdiction must produce names because neighboring jurisdictions have done so.
The source’s profile of Shi Bi is therefore not passive noncompliance. He states a reasoned boundary: differences in local custom and evidence matter, and using superior pressure to frame innocent households would make all Pingyuan residents vulnerable. His near-punishment and later local respect make him the episode’s clearest case of official integrity under a coercive reporting campaign.

Evidence
- No-name report: Hanji 877 says Shi Bi reports that Pingyuan has no party figures while other commanderies and kingdoms submit many names.
- Superior pressure: Hanji 877 says repeated orders and Qingzhou questioning pressure him to produce a list.
- Evidence boundary: Hanji 877 says Shi Bi argues that different places can have different customs, so other jurisdictions’ reports do not prove Pingyuan has party figures.
- Innocent-household protection: Hanji 877 says Shi Bi refuses to falsely accuse good people merely to satisfy official expectations.
- Amnesty outcome: Hanji 877 says an amnesty prevents heavier punishment, leaving only a fine of several months’ salary.
